Anthony Mackie has been deservedly rising to recognition brilliantly in recent years, with strong supporting roles in the likes of The Hurt Locker, The Adjustment Bureau, and Real Steel.

His upcoming slate includes Abraham Lincoln: Vampire Hunter, Ruben Fleischer’s highly anticipated Gangster Squad (the trailer for which landed this month), and Michael Bay’s Pain and Gain.

Deadline now report that the young star is now in talks to join crime-thriller Runner, Runner alongside leading men Ben Affleck and Justin Timberlake, which already sounds like something to look forward to in itself.

“The drama revolves around the world of offshore online gaming and an increasingly tense relationship between a business founder and his protege.”

Brad Furman, who made waves last year with The Lincoln Lawyer, will be back behind the camera, directing from a script co-written by frequent collaborators Brian Koppelman and David Levien (Rounders, Ocean’s Thirteen), with Leonardo DiCaprio producing under his Appian Way banner.
